Key Responsibilities:
- Conducting Tests:
- Ensure all necessary test equipment and materials are in good working condition.
- Review design specifications schematics and other technical documents to understand the requirements and performance criteria of the electrical systems.
- Perform final acceptance tests on electrical systems including functional performance and safety tests.
- Troubleshoot and diagnose issues working with design and production teams to implement corrective actions.
- Ensure all testing activities comply with industry standards company policies and regulatory requirements.
- Documentation and Reporting:
- Compile comprehensive test reports including test results observations and any identified issues.
- Maintain accurate and organized records of all tests performed and their outcomes.
- Communicate test results and findings to relevant stakeholders including engineers and project managers.
- Continuous Improvement:
- Participate in post-test reviews and contribute to continuous improvement initiatives.
- Provide feedback and recommendations to improve product design manufacturing processes and testing procedures.
